According to Pádraig Brady on 2/1/2010 7:08 AM:
> On 26/01/10 11:49, Pádraig Brady wrote:
>> There are 2 questions with this.
>>
>> 1. Since this is only specific to --check-order really, perhaps
>> we should add it as a parameter like --check-order=+N where N
>> is the number of lines to skip checks on, and output as header lines.
That actually sounds like a good idea, of accepting an optional argument
(defaulting to 0). And it works well since --check-order has no short option.
>>
>> 2. Do we want to output headings from the first file
>> when they don't match the second?
I'm not as sure on this one.
